E-mail address check

E-mail addresses are also often being changed without notice or unreachable for a long period. The 'Contact person' are primarily approached by e-mail so this field should be correct and current at all times.

====Rules==== The e-mail address:

  1. is valid
  2. is does not bounce
  3. is actually read

If the above is not true, then action should be undertaken, like dropping the record.
